网页资讯视频图片知道文库贴吧地图采购
进入贴吧全吧搜索

 
 
 
日一二三四五六
       
       
       
       
       
       

签到排名:今日本吧第个签到,

本吧因你更精彩,明天继续来努力!

本吧签到人数:0

一键签到
成为超级会员,使用一键签到
一键签到
本月漏签0次!
0
成为超级会员,赠送8张补签卡
如何使用?
点击日历上漏签日期,即可进行补签。
连续签到:天  累计签到:天
0
超级会员单次开通12个月以上,赠送连续签到卡3张
使用连续签到卡
02月07日漏签0天
嵌入式吧 关注:101,969贴子:456,148
  • 看贴

  • 图片

  • 吧主推荐

  • 游戏

  • 首页 上一页 1 2 3 4 下一页 尾页
  • 88回复贴,共4页
  • ,跳到 页  
<<返回嵌入式吧
>0< 加载中...

回复:蓝牙已连接---一命速通nordic篇

  • 只看楼主
  • 收藏

  • 回复
  • 流白🌨
  • 导线
    1
该楼层疑似违规已被系统折叠 隐藏此楼查看此楼
sdk_config里面还有个蓝牙协议栈的宏配置,跟ios有关的,我记得是让中心设备动态获取服务信息啥的,这个建议打开,当时测试dfu升级的时候,如果新版本程序添加了新服务或者新特征值,ios设备可能会从系统缓存中拿以前的属性而不是向外围设备重新拿


  • 流白🌨
  • 导线
    1
该楼层疑似违规已被系统折叠 隐藏此楼查看此楼
还有就是它的RTT打印是真的拉,打印频率稍微高一点就会丢一大堆的信息建议准备两套工程,一个开蓝牙一个不开,用不开那个专门测试各种外设的应用逻辑然后再合并到蓝牙工程里面,以及它那个APP_ERR_CHECK那个宏函数,在调试的时候可以带上,会自动进协议栈断点获取断点信息啥的,等实际的release版本建议都注释掉别用,省的哪一次出问题导致程序死了


2026-02-07 21:22:57
广告
不感兴趣
开通SVIP免广告
  • 陆戮浜庡績258
  • 小吧主
    12
该楼层疑似违规已被系统折叠 隐藏此楼查看此楼

在家里你可以叫我函数,出了这个门你要叫我什么,高贵的服务


  • 陆戮浜庡績258
  • 小吧主
    12
该楼层疑似违规已被系统折叠 隐藏此楼查看此楼
点灯环节由以下几个步骤组成
1.蓝牙怎么知道你要点灯呢,首先要在协议栈里的Profiles层里创建函数,不现在叫服务了

第一件事主服务的建立(也就是创建控制灯的蓝牙回调函数),第二件事添加基础UUID+此次控灯操作的UUID,第三件事空中传输数据的读写配置,最后就是协议栈的精华--传参,这玩意太逆天了,之前看手动配置看得我头昏眼花,没有这api,要面临的将是这种直接原地去世


  • 陆戮浜庡績258
  • 小吧主
    12
该楼层疑似违规已被系统折叠 隐藏此楼查看此楼
2.就是这个神奇的观察者函数,只要监控到有数据传输就会调用此回调函数ble_lbs_on_ble_evt,并且传参
3.此回调函数判断事件类型,并且将参数带到下一个回调函数on_write,进行写入操作
4.接下来就是此回调函数将获取到的值,继续传入第1处的回调函数led_write_handler,
咱们来看看53行有何玄机,取结构体里的联合体的结构体的联合体的成员值,兼职布诗人

5.最后调用了led_write_handler回调函数形成闭环,实现点灯
至此完成了所有点灯操作,成功进阶为蓝牙点灯带师,可以跟面试老登说熟悉蓝牙5.0协议栈了,任重道远,痛并快乐


  • jilh一把子
  • 启动代码
    7
该楼层疑似违规已被系统折叠 隐藏此楼查看此楼


  • 百炼成砖
  • 板级软件
    10
该楼层疑似违规已被系统折叠 隐藏此楼查看此楼
什么时候面


  • 白日梦想家
  • 系统芯片
    11
该楼层疑似违规已被系统折叠 隐藏此楼查看此楼
大佬


2026-02-07 21:16:57
广告
不感兴趣
开通SVIP免广告
  • 陆戮浜庡績258
  • 小吧主
    12
该楼层疑似违规已被系统折叠 隐藏此楼查看此楼
接下来是蓝牙必不可少的电池服务,还有心电服务,这两玩意也是api没啥好说的,用自带的库和公式计算电池电量,蓝牙串口透传模式老规矩创建服务

主要关注这两个回调函数,手机app发送数据到芯片串口打印触发这个回调事件nus_data_handler

从串口芯片发送到手机app触发这个回调事件uart_event_handle


  • 贴吧用户_QtJCDVW
  • 导线
    1
该楼层疑似违规已被系统折叠 隐藏此楼查看此楼
好帖


  • 陆戮浜庡績258
  • 小吧主
    12
该楼层疑似违规已被系统折叠 隐藏此楼查看此楼
书接上回,既然知道了协议栈传输数据的api-nus_data_handler,那当然是狠狠嵌入自己需要的业务逻辑了,康康所谓的蓝牙遥控器是怎么个事,app输入框数据发送,协议栈数据条件解析完事


  • 贴吧用户_G5XVPPN
  • 寄存器
    4
该楼层疑似违规已被系统折叠 隐藏此楼查看此楼
陆总音频方向行业怎么样啊我是25届的小登


  • 贴吧用户_577W3UM
  • 微控制器
    6
该楼层疑似违规已被系统折叠 隐藏此楼查看此楼
陆总我也打算学习蓝牙,硬件平台选esp32好还是nrf528好


  • 明习塞外江南
  • 导线
    1
该楼层疑似违规已被系统折叠 隐藏此楼查看此楼
学习nordic是不是还要先买个正点原子的烧录器啊,看到烧录器都有点贵


2026-02-07 21:10:57
广告
不感兴趣
开通SVIP免广告
  • 24的小哥哥
  • 电阻
    2
该楼层疑似违规已被系统折叠 隐藏此楼查看此楼
有做成套蓝牙方案一拖八的能力吗


登录百度账号

扫二维码下载贴吧客户端

下载贴吧APP
看高清直播、视频!
  • 贴吧页面意见反馈
  • 违规贴吧举报反馈通道
  • 贴吧违规信息处理公示
  • 首页 上一页 1 2 3 4 下一页 尾页
  • 88回复贴,共4页
  • ,跳到 页  
<<返回嵌入式吧
分享到:
©2026 Baidu贴吧协议|隐私政策|吧主制度|意见反馈|网络谣言警示